DES MOINES, IA (IRN) – Former President Donald Trump will hold a rally at the Iowa State Fairgrounds on Oct. 9. The former president’s return to the first-in-the-nation caucus state is likely to stoke speculation about whether he’ll again seek the White House in 2024. His potential Republican rivals aren’t waiting for Trump to announce his intentions. A host of possible presidential contenders have already begun visiting Iowa to hold fundraisers for local candidates and attend party dinners.
AMES, IA (IRN) – Two people died on Interstate 35 Tuesday following a crash involving several vehicles south of Ames. A semi-truck crashed into the trailer of another semi before hitting a van and truck. The impact of the crash caused the truck to hit another semi.
IOWA (IRN) Iowa hospitals and nursing homes report a decline in nurses as COVID-19 cases continue to rise. According to a study released by the Iowa Board of Nursing, demand for nurses across the state is high and the nursing shortage is widespread.
NORTH LIBERTY, IA (IRN) – The Iowa Board of Regents on Tuesday approved a plan by the University of Iowa Hospitals and Clinics to build a $230 million hospital in North Liberty. The vote came a week after it was advanced by a state council over dozens of objections. Opponents say the planned 300,000-square-foot, four-story, 48-bed hospital will run community hospitals in the area out of business.
DYERSVILLE, IA (IRN) – A manufacturing company from Wisconsin is expanding into Iowa and has chosen Dyersville for its new location. Zero Zone makes refrigeration and freezing units for grocery and convenience stores and plans on opening a new facility in Dyersville early next year. The company will create 50 new jobs.
